创建一个敏捷开发平台涉及多个步骤,从需求分析到持续优化和改进。以下是详细的步骤概述:
敏捷开发平台的创建步骤
- 需求收集和分析:与利益相关者深入沟通,理解他们的需求和期望。
- 项目规划和设计:制定项目计划,确定目标、范围和预期结果,并进行系统设计。
- 迭代开发和测试:分阶段、分模块进行开发,每个迭代周期结束后进行系统测试。
- 持续集成和部署:将功能模块集成到系统中,进行部署和测试。
- 反馈和优化:收集用户反馈,根据反馈信息进行优化和改进。
敏捷开发平台的优势
- 提高开发效率:通过快速迭代和灵活响应变化。
- 更好的测试效果:强调自动化测试,提高测试效率和准确性。
- 更高的可伸缩性:适应不断变化的需求和技术发展。
- 促进团队协作:通过自组织团队和有效的沟通机制。
常见的敏捷开发平台
- PingCode:国内成熟的敏捷项目管理系统,支持多种敏捷开发管理方法和混合模型。
- OpenProject:开源项目管理工具,适合各种规模和行业的团队。
- TAPD:腾讯开发的敏捷产品开发管理平台,适用于各种规模的团队,特别是需要敏捷开发和持续集成的技术团队。
通过上述步骤,你可以创建一个高效、灵活的敏捷开发平台,以适应快速变化的市场需求,提高软件开发的质量和效率。